Add 49/9 and 2/4

1st number: 5 4/9, 2nd number: 2/4

49/9 + 2/4 is 107/18.

Steps for adding fractions

  1. Find the least common denominator or LCM of the two denominators:
    LCM of 9 and 4 is 36

    Next, find the equivalent fraction of both fractional numbers with denominator 36
  2. For the 1st fraction, since 9 × 4 = 36,
    49/9 = 49 × 4/9 × 4 = 196/36
  3. Likewise, for the 2nd fraction, since 4 × 9 = 36,
    2/4 = 2 × 9/4 × 9 = 18/36
  4. Add the two like fractions:
    196/36 + 18/36 = 196 + 18/36 = 214/36
  5. 214/36 simplified gives 107/18
  6. So, 49/9 + 2/4 = 107/18
